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2127981 100949841 0816321 001096 1934087630
798835017 83 7317429
798835017 83 7317429
77374266837 5013 0550 19144231044
All about undefined
Interested in learning more?
798835017 83 7317429
77374266837 5013 0550 19144231044
See more
16 09
154 09373569603 861 09
See more
32 1127966 873514212
6936 31 55645118645
See more